Good afternoon - swapped a 2003 Ranger 4.0 into our 2001 Ranger 4.0 and got codes: P1401 & P0340

Swapped Cam Sensor - same code. Started looking into wiring and noticed mechanic stuffed this plug down behind wiring on driver's side of motor above valve cover. Anyone know where it goes and if it is contributing to these codes? Thanks!

UPDATE - a little research and it looks like a 2003 motor doesn't have EGR or DPFE correct?

Is there anything I need to do for this 2003 into a 2001 swap that the mechanic didn't do?
• Install the 2001 emissions (looks like the EGR is installed, but not the DPFE)
• anything else?
